2. Structural Integrity

Another practical reason for this chocolate layer is its role in maintaining the structural integrity of the Cornetto.

  • Acts as a Barrier: The melted chocolate forms a barrier that helps to hold the ice cream in place, preventing it from dripping out of the bottom and creating a mess. This makes the Cornetto easier to enjoy without worrying about losing any of the creamy goodness.

  • Prevents Sogginess: As ice cream melts, it can seep into the cone, creating an undesirable soggy texture. The chocolate seals the bottom, reducing the likelihood of this occurring.

How is the chocolate added to Cornettos?

The process of adding chocolate to Cornettos is quite ingenious. Before the ice cream is poured into the cone, a layer of melted chocolate is carefully placed at the bottom of the cone. This chocolate is allowed to harden, creating a solid barrier that will keep the filling secure once the ice cream is added.

The application of chocolate is a key part of the manufacturing process, as it ensures that the layer is thick enough to prevent leaking but not so thick that it overshadows the other flavors. This method ensures that each Cornetto is uniformly filled, providing a consistent experience for consumers.

Can I make a homemade version of a Cornetto with chocolate at the bottom?

Creating a homemade version of a Cornetto with chocolate at the bottom is indeed possible and can be a fun project. To do this, start by melting some chocolate and pouring it into the bottom of a cone, allowing it to harden before adding in your preferred ice cream. This DIY approach allows you to experiment with flavors and customize the treat according to your taste preferences.
